Kidd’s triple-double powers Nets to win

New Jersey Nets' Jason Kidd, right, drives the ball down court as and Philadelphia 76ers Louis Williams defends during the fourth quarter of an NBA basketball game Saturday, Nov. 3, 2007, in Philadelphia.

Jason Kidd made it a nifty 50 with New Jersey. Kidd posted his 50th triple-double with the Nets, his box score stuffed again with 16 points, 14 rebounds and 10 assists in New Jersey’s 93-88 win over the Philadelphia 76ers on Saturday night. “Oh, he had a triple-double?” said teammate Richard Jefferson, with a smile.

Heat Focused On Damian Lillard With Belief He Could Seek TradeHeat Focused On Damian Lillard With Belief He Could Seek Trade

The Miami Heat did not trade for Bradley Beal as they keep their focus on Damian Lillard, sources tell Chris Haynes of Bleacher Report.

There is a “genuine belief this could be the offseason [Lillard] seeks a change of scenery,” adds Haynes.

There have so far been no public indications that Lillard is entertaining requesting a trade from the Portland Trail Blazers.

The Blazers own the No. 3 pick in this week’s draft and Lillard has been clear in his preference for the team to add win-now players to the roster to improve their odds of becoming a contending team in the Western Conference again.

The Heat presumably could have offered the Washington Wizards a more attractive package of assets than the Phoenix Suns considering they own several of their own first round picks outright.
